    Ok, I just watched the end of the Ravens and Steelers game. I could be wrong but if my calculations are correct on the total yardage between the Steelers and Ravens , in addition to the total yards we gave up to the Browns today. We are unofficially the # 1 defense on total defense as of this week. I wasn't sure if we could break the top two but if I calculated correctly then our total defense is at 274 per game.The Steelers total defense is at 280 per game and the Ravens ( based on 8 games) are at a shade over 279 per game. I am so impressed with this defense after losing Mario for the year and Manning for quite a few games. Brooks Reed has really stepped in and done a great job. Life is good :)
